Jēkabpils novada Kultūras pārvalde (registration number 40900009295) announces an open competition for the position of Gārsenes Tautas nama Director (for an indefinite term)
Main job duties:
1. lead, plan, organize, and coordinate the operations and finances of the cultural center in accordance with legal and regulatory requirements;
2. organize and ensure the implementation of administrative and operational matters for the cultural center;
3. prepare draft documents for institutional management and operational matters;
4. participate in committees and working groups in accordance with directives from the Head of Jēkabpils novada Kultūras pārvalde and prepare necessary documentation;
5. prepare budget estimates for the cultural center and coordinate efficient budget utilization;
6. plan, organize, and lead cultural and recreational events at Gārsenes Tautas nama, in Aknīste city, and at other event venues, and monitor the use of allocated event funds;
7. prepare event plans and draft event budgets;
8. participate in project competitions organized by the city, municipalities, and various funds; promote fundraising for events;
9. establish cooperation with media outlets, inform the public about events and activities, and ensure event promotional campaigns;
10. prepare reports to the copyright agency within specified deadlines and ensure copyright compliance at events;
11. cooperate with amateur arts collectives, coordinate and organize their work, and address various matters related to collective operations;
12. plan facilities and schedules for events and rehearsals, maintain facility order before and after events, and provide on-site support at cultural events if necessary;
13. monitor compliance with occupational safety, data protection, electrical safety, and fire safety regulations during collective activities, concerts, and performances.
Requirements for candidates:
1. higher education in humanities, cultural management, or professional secondary education in the cultural field with completion of a licensed professional development program in cultural management;
2. work experience in cultural management;
3. excellent organizational, communication, and collaboration skills;
4. ability to set priorities, organize, and plan work;
5. conceptual thinking, positive attitude toward innovation, creativity, and initiative;
6. orientation toward development and achievement of results;
7. proficiency in Microsoft Office and other software in a Windows environment at an experienced user level.
We offer:
1. personal growth and professional development opportunities;
2. dynamic and creative work in a friendly team;
3. social benefits and stable compensation of €1300.00.
